Web21 Feb 2015 · This seems to be a Raspberry Pi 2 specific... but also new kernel to support armv7 that only occurs with specific models of the Seagate drives. You have a two options really: in /boot/cmdline.txt add the line, or change it if its there to: rootdelay=5 or rootdelay=10 (Causes a delay for USB to initialise)
